    It is very common for rookies to hit a \"wall\" at some point.

    Even when surrounded by veterans, the wear and tear, travel,team commitments are far beyond anything they have experienced. Without Toews and Havlat in the lineup other teams can focus on kane, and generally put their strongest defence pairings out against him.

    Consider the fanfare around Kane and Toews, not to mention the promotional load as the \"future of the hawks\" and the \"slump\" should be expected.

    If you recall the days before Crosby/Ovechkin a 53 point pace for a rookie, was great. It is us fantasy fans that are spoiled now.

    Be patient and enjoy a long and prosperous career.

    Another way to put it would be: is Toews the main driver for Kane\'s production?
    Yea, they feed off each other very well. I knew that when Havlat came back and they briefly made the line Kane-Toews-Havlat it would be a disaster....now it\'s Kane-Lang-Havlat or substitute Lang for Sharp. Kane does not play well with Havlat. He defers to him TOO much. Kane is a playmaker, not a force-feeder and Havlat thinks it\'s his God given right to have the puck spoon fed to him. I think once Kane gets on the line with Toews and Lang sticks it out with Havlat, you\'ll see an increase in production from both players.
